    Having completed the Flagstaff Beer Passport, experiencing breweries' ambiance & their beer, Wanderlust was quite the special place. The smallest brewery on the passport- located further outside downtown Flagstaff, many locals we met at other breweries noted they haven't made it out there- and we filled them in they were missing out- The small brewery had the most friendly staff, who spent a good amount of time discussing beer preferences, styles, and suggestions with us- not just for Wanderlust but AZ beer in general- they allowed for samples before committing to a full pour- We opted for the IPAs- they had a HH $4pour for their Farmhouse Saison & Lager at the time (a rotating HH I was told) They are pet friendly, byof (but have snacks available for purchase) have cornhole boards, dart board, and lots of spacious seating- We sat at a high top in the back seating area-and had the pleasure of chatting with one of the owners about their beer experience in AZ, and met some locals who gave hiking recommendations-the ambiance of this was hometown pride, brewery pride, and community feeling- Each beer (Tropical Borealis & 988) were very unique quality flavor of hazy citra-5 untapped stars- average $7 pint pour If we were closer we'd love being regulars-highly recommend

    Nick L.

    Super chill brewery just a couple minutes outside downtown Flagstaff. L.B. is a very personable beertender, and she can help answer any questions about beers available. This brewery specializes in more traditional beer styles like Farmhouse Saisons and Weizens, but they they have a well balanced menu for any style including a hard kombucha and a couple seltzers. There are some non-alcoholic options (sodas and powerade) and $1 snacks (chips and cookies) available as well. Dog friendly so feel free to bring your pups! Cornhole boards (warmer weather) and dart boards for entertainment.

    Cody N.

    This is definitely one of the top breweries in Flagstaff. This place is more of a traditional brewery, so not too many added extras like food, or games. However, the beer speaks for itself with how amazing it is. There is a wide selection of beers from German, Belgian, stouts, IPAs, and sours. They even have their own line of Hard seltzers for people who aren't into beer but want to join in on the fun. My favorite part is they allow dogs inside the brewery. So rain, snow, or sunshine, your furry friend can tag along too. Add this place to your list of breweries to stop at if you are in flag, or plan to be.

    Craig B.

    Industrial brewery with fermenters, wood bar, and seating in one big room. All the features you want in a brewery. Banjo Bill's Blackberry Sour and the Pan American Stout were the best beers we had in our flight. The Blackberry Sour is a good introductory sour. It's smooth, light, distinctly sour, yet not a punch in your face strong sour.
